The invention discloses an unmanned aerial vehicle lifting platform which comprises a rack, a landing platform arranged on the rack, a lifting mechanism arranged on the rack and movable plate frames symmetrically arranged on the landing platform, buffer pieces are symmetrically arranged on each movable plate frame, and limiting frames are arranged on the two sides of each movable plate frame. A fixed frame is arranged on each limiting frame, an arc-shaped limiting clamping jaw is arranged on one side of each fixed frame, a driving mechanism is arranged in each fixed frame, and response buttons are symmetrically arranged on the movable plate frame. According to the unmanned aerial vehicle lifting platform, the descending position of an unmanned aerial vehicle is determined through an annular panel and a rubber pad on the annular panel, and after the unmanned aerial vehicle descends to a certain position, the unmanned aerial vehicle is lifted to a certain position; and the electromagnet sets act on the response buttons under the action of the touch rod frames, the electromagnet sets are powered on to generate repelling acting force on the sliding plate frames, so that the arc-shaped limiting clamping jaws are driven to limit the bottom rack of the unmanned aerial vehicle under the action of the extension rod bodies, the square frame, the supporting frame, the sliding block bodies and the reinforcing rod frames, and collision accidents are effectively avoided.
